How to Assess Developer Credibility in Bhiwadi’s Thriving Real Estate Market Bhiwadi, a rapidly growing Tier II city near NH-8, offers affordability and industrial opportunities, making it a prime real estate destination. However, with increasing development activity, verifying developer credibility is crucial for secure investments. Here’s a structured checklist to evaluate builders’ trustworthiness.

Evaluating Builder Reputation

  1. Check RERA Registration

    • Confirm builder registration under the Real Estate Regulatory Act (RERA) using state portals. Non-compliance signals red flags.
    • Cross-reference project approvals with official documents to avoid fraudulent claims.
  2. Review Past Projects

    • Inspect completed projects for structural quality and timely delivery. Developers like Avalon Group have multiple projects in the Tapukara Industrial Area.
    • Interview existing residents or review online testimonials to gauge post-construction support.
  3. Examine Financial Health

    • Request audited financial statements to ensure solvency. Large projects often require partnerships with banks or investors.
    • Investigate debt obligations to avoid stalled projects due to insufficient funds.

Project Completion Timelines

  1. Study Construction Histories

    • Analyze the developer’s track record for meeting deadlines. For instance, Honda’s workforce expansion spurred housing projects—track their execution timelines.
    • Review contractual penalties for delays in agreements to understand accountability measures.
  2. Check Approval Documents

    • Cross-check construction deeds with local authority sanctions. Legal verification is a recurring theme in Bhiwadi’s real estate guidelines.
    • Scrutinize phasing plans to ensure sequential development aligns with promised timelines.
  3. Monitor Milestones Digitally

    • Utilize developer portals or project dashboards for real-time updates.
    • Schedule site visits to confirm physical progress against documented schedules.

Quality Standards Checklist

  1. Inspect Material Quality

    • Identify contractors and suppliers through agreements. Trusted materials are critical, as seen in integrated townships with modern amenities.
    • Request samples for civil works to assess durability.
  2. Validate Compliance Certifications

    • Ensure ISO certifications for water and electrical systems, given Bhiwadi’s emphasis on robust infrastructure.
    • Confirm adherence to national building codes (NBC) for safety and sustainability.
  3. Review Post-Construction Support

    • Investigate maintenance contracts and warranty periods. Premium developers offer extended support for common areas.
    • Verify amenities like parks, schools, and hospitals as mention in documents.
